When it comes to replacing missing teeth, there are several options available. One popular choice is a partial acrylic denture. This type of denture is a removable prosthesis that is commonly used to replace one or more missing teeth in the upper or lower jaw. In this article, we will explore what partial acrylic dentures are, how they work, and the benefits they offer.
partial acrylic dentures are made from a combination of acrylic resin and metal. The base of the denture is typically made from acrylic resin, which is a lightweight and durable material that is custom-shaped to fit the patient’s mouth. Metal clasps or attachments are added to the denture to help secure it in place and prevent it from moving around when the patient talks or eats.
The process of getting a partial acrylic denture starts with a consultation with a dental professional. During this appointment, the dentist will evaluate the patient’s oral health and determine if a partial denture is the best option for replacing missing teeth. If a partial acrylic denture is recommended, the dentist will take impressions of the patient’s mouth to create a custom-fitted denture that will look and feel natural.
Once the partial acrylic denture is ready, the dentist will show the patient how to insert and remove it properly. It may take some time for the patient to get used to wearing the denture, but with practice, it should become more comfortable. The dentist will also provide instructions on how to clean and care for the denture to ensure its longevity.
There are several benefits to choosing a partial acrylic denture to replace missing teeth. One of the main advantages is that they are more affordable than other options, such as dental implants or bridges. Partial dentures are also removable, making them easy to clean and maintain. They can be a good option for patients who are not candidates for other types of dental restorations, such as dental implants.
Another benefit of partial acrylic dentures is that they can help improve the appearance of the smile and restore confidence in patients who have missing teeth. By filling in gaps and spaces in the mouth, partial dentures can give patients a natural-looking smile that they can be proud of. This can have a positive impact on their overall quality of life and self-esteem.
partial acrylic dentures are also a versatile option for replacing missing teeth. They can be used to replace just one tooth or several teeth, depending on the patient’s needs. This makes them a practical choice for patients who have multiple missing teeth in different areas of the mouth. Additionally, partial dentures can be easily adjusted or repaired if they become damaged, allowing patients to maintain their oral health and function.
